MONTREAL — The decision to return to play was not taken lightly by Justin Morrow and his Toronto FC teammates, who wrestled with the implications of their actions for the last two days.

"For me, it was incredibly tough to play tonight," said Morrow, the executive director of the BPC."There were a lot of players on Montreal that didn't want to play. But MLS resumed activities following a meeting between players, the players association and the BPC. Morrow called the discussions leading up to that decision"chaotic" and"exhausting."

Players from both teams wore"Black Lives Matter" t-shirts in the pre-game warmup and took a knee in a moment of reflection prior to the game's opening whistle. Most players also knelt during the anthem. "In the end, we didn't want to play today but we felt nobody had our backs. We're a little disappointed by a few of our opponents."

They made a small dent in the 20,801-seat venue but chanted and cheered throughout the game. Some waved rainbow-coloured flags in support of Pride Night in MLS. Fans outside the stadium provided even more atmosphere by setting off fireworks every few minutes.
